If I was rich, I would buy you anything you wanted.
上句中的 was 是否应当改为 were?
在正式语体里,这里应当用 were。但是,我们在教学或考试中切不要把这里的 was 看作是错误,因为在不大正式的语体里,人们常常使用 was 来代替 were。下面是我们收集到的一些正面例句:
-
If I were [was] rich, I would buy anything you wanted. (CGEL) 如果我有钱的话, 我会给你买你所需要的一切。
-
If she was here, she would speak on my behalf. (CGEL) 如果她在这儿的话, 她会代表我讲话的。
-
If I were (was) to ask, would you help me? (LEG) 如果我提出请求,你会帮助我吗?
-
If it was to rain, the ropes would snap. They're far too tight. (CGEL) 如果下雨, 绳子就会断。绳子系得太紧了。
-
If he was my friend, he would speak for my case. (Leech) 如果他是我的朋友的话,他就会为我的案件说话。
-
And if I wasn't a Senator, I certainly would be trying to influence those who were. (Hillary, Living History) 假使我不是参议员,我一定会设法影响参议院里的这些人。(希拉里,《亲历历史》)
Leech 说, 现在经常(虽然不是通常)用 was 来代替 were。但是, 在 if I were you, as it were, if it were not for 等结构中, were 是不能用 was 来代替的。
应当指出,在现代英语里,人们不仅仅在口语里用 was 来代替 were,而且在书面语里也常常如此。例如,我们在美国的一本物理教科书中就发现了许多这种用法的实例。
